Transport and sustainability: The social pillar
Sustainable transport systems enhance social inclusion, reduce environmental problems and help create a more efficient economy; raising quality of life.
Not all three aspects of sustainability are dealt with equally in European transport. Economics is thoroughly discussed and environmental issues are well-publicised. But transport’s social problems are often unclear, and the social/psychological factors supporting transport patterns are often forgotten.
